Often described by gem aficionados as “emerald by day, ruby by night,” alexandrite is the very rare colour-changing gem mineral that is part of the chrysoberyl family. Alexandrite’s are one of the rarest gemstones, normally found in small quantities when mined with limited production, making them also one of the most expensive gems.
